WebApr 25, 2024 · 1 Answer. The T470 can be charged via USB-C (Lenovo even sells such chargers as accessories for the T470) , so if your MacBook Pro charger is a USB-C charger it should work. Charging may be faster or slower than via the regular T470 …

WebLenovo USB-C charging circuits demand 20V for either 45W or 65W (2.25A and 3.25A, respectively). Your phone charger probably does not have the 20V circuitry because it's designed for your phone, which has a ~3.6V lithium battery and can quite easily be charged with plain old 5V.

Worst case scenario is it won't work. I'm pretty convinced both chargers are USB-PD compliant because 20V, 15V, 9V and 5V are voltages USB-PD spec defines. The device will negotiate charging voltage with the adapter. Voltage variations on Apple's charger are within 5%, that's perfectly fine. covid pch guidelineWebMay 19, 2024 · charge my iphone 11 using lenovo ThinkPad USB-C Dock Gen 2 or 20W USB C power adapter I have got Lenovo ThinkPad USB-C Dock Gen 2 which supports to charge my iphone 11 using the TypeC to lightning cable.
